Clearing tree history in ConsoleOne

Novell Cool Solutions: Question & Answer

Posted: 26 Oct 2005

Q:
Does anyone know how to delete entries or clear the "tree history" drop box in the ConsoleOne authentication dialog box? I have several dead test/dev trees in the list that are no longer required.

A:
This info gets written to the file SnapinPrefs.ser in .consoleone directory in the users profile directory. You can delete the file to get the history list cleared out. Other settings may revert back to their defaults when you delete this file. The file gets created when you successfully log in to ConsoleOne.
